cann someone tell me what is the diffrent between the steam version and the non steam version. i dont get it. why you dont buy the non-steam version?

 

i really wanted to know, why everbody want a steam version from every airplane.

 

The Steam and Non steam accounts are seperate (to some extent).

 

So if someone has all of their aircraft on a STEAM DCS and they buy a non steam Mirage 2000 they would likely need two different DCS Clients to fly all of their aircraft (since they could not fly the Mirage 2000 through the Steam client and they could not use their other aircraft through the non steam client)

 

Since the CD keys for the modules might not fit.

 

And as such those who have all of their aircraft through Steam they need to wait for the steam release to have the mirage 2000 on the same DCS Client/account as their other Aircraft.

Posted

The stand-alone client can use ALL keys no matter where they are bought from.

 

Steam client can only use keys bought from the steam store.

Some bad info in here.

 

STEAM keys will work anywhere.

 

DCS keys will work only in the standalone version of DCS, because Valve is no longer supporting porting keys over; this has nothing to do with ED.

 

 

There is no reason to have the Steam version of DCS; download the standalone, all your controls and modules will automatically be copied. It will use all of your same user files from your Steam installation.

 

You will have access to any early access planes you might want to fly (like the Viggen, Mirage, and hopefully soon Hornet) and patches will come sooner.

 

You lose absolutely nothing by moving to standalone, and gain significantly.

 

If you want the Steam overlay in Standalone DCS, open Steam and click Games -> Add a Non-Steam Game to My Library
